Sesshin, literally “to collect the mind”, is the Zen Buddhist seclusion or intensive period, consisting of 3-14 days of silent meditative practices. Included in these periods are daily zazen (meditation), chanting, communal meals, Dharma Talks (sermons), samu (work) periods, and private interview twice daily with Ryuun Joriki Baker, Osho.
During Sesshin, the student concentrates fully on their practice. They open themselves to the tools of the Rinzai Zen Buddhist tradition and the sangha which surrounds them. Together they realize their true nature. A nature rooted within the spring of primal wisdom from which all Buddhas arise from. It is beyond word and letter. Sesshin is a time to dedicate ourselves to the exploration of this great matter, and a time to realize the vast wonder and beauty that surrounds us, right here and right now.
